Medical imaging involves the imagines copied by medical video equipments such as CT and MRI. The division of medical imaging is a key technology to deal with and analyze medical imaging. It is also a course splitting the imagines into umpty areas based on the similarities and differences of the areas. The bottleneck of development and application in condition of other relative technologies handling medical imaging and the first issue about analyzing and identifying medical imaging is how to divide the imagines from the relative organizations. From the medical research and the clinical application's angle, the objective of the imaging division is that the original 2D or 3D imagines are split into the areas with the different characters, is to distill and display the interested areas of them, is to get close to the result of dissection, and is to offer the credible basis for the clinical consultation and the scientific study of diseases.MITK is a C++ class libraries exploited into the integrated medical imaging transaction and analysis by Institute of Automation of Academia Sinica. As similar as the style of VTK, it offers to a series of tools which have characters of the consistent interface, multiplexing and high efficiency for the functions involving splitting medical imagines, registering and visualization. It also uses the traditional design methods for the object rather than the style of ITK's pattern serial number, as it is easier to be used with the simper and direct character of the grammar and interface. At present, it has been an exploitative tool used by national researchers on medical imaging handling.The objective and purport of task: Recently the main carving algorithm of the imagines involves the division of the value of a threshold, region growing, interactive division, live wire, fast marching and water level set. Although every algorithm prior to aim at one part or character of the imagines, however, none of them can be applied in all of the medical imaginings.Under the VC's condition, the task focus on the main trend of the division algorithm of the medical imaging based on that MITK uses MFC to exploit the division system of medical imaging. At the same time, to fill up the deficiency from not enough fecundity of MITK algorithm, the task designed MITK and a data interface in the medical developed handling packages ITK which is popular on international area recently. It expands the functions of MITK, and solves the issues about non-visualization of ITK.
